The mechanism below show the component used in exhaust port of internal combustion engine. Cam forces rocker arm at point B with velocity of 30mm/s. Determine angular velocity of angular plate and velocity at point C.
Example
![Page 14: Kinematic and Motion](https://reader035.fdocuments.net/reader035/viewer/2022062301/56813b75550346895da4824a/html5/thumbnails/14.jpg)
W2= vb/rb
=30/20 = 1.5 rad/s Vc= rw =15 mm x 1.5 rad/s =22.5 mm/s

A flywheel with diameter of 200 mm accelerates from 2000 rpm to 6000 rpm
within 10 s. Determine its tangent and normal acceleration.
Example
![Page 21: Kinematic and Motion](https://reader035.fdocuments.net/reader035/viewer/2022062301/56813b75550346895da4824a/html5/thumbnails/21.jpg)
Answer; 2000 rpm= 209.44 rad/s 6000 rpm= 628.32 rad/s 𝜶=41.892 at = (41.892)x( 0.1)=4.1 At 2000 rpm an= (209.44)2x(0.2) = 8773.02 m/s2
At 6000 rpm an= (628.32)2x(0.2) = 78957.2 m/s2
